IMPALA-3915: Register privilege and audit requests when analyzing resolved 
table refs.

The bug: We used to register privilege requests for table refs in 
TableRef.analyze()
which only got called for unresolved TableRefs. As a result, a reference to a 
view that
contains a subquery did not get properly authorized, explained as follows.
1. In the first analysis pass the view is replaced by a an InlineViewRef and we
   correctly register an authorizarion request.
2. We rewrite the subquery via the StmtRewriter and wipe the analysis state, but
   preserve the InlineViewRef that replaces the view reference.
3. The rewritten statement is analyzed again, but since an InlineViewRef is
   considered to be resolved, we never call TableRef.analyze(), and hence
   never register an authorization event for the view.

The fix: We now register authorization and auditing events when calling 
analyze() on a
resolved TableRef (BaseTableRef, InlineViewRef, CollectionTableRef).
